Gamblers are often influenced by cognitive biases, which affect how they perceive risks and rewards. For instance, the gambler’s fallacy—a common misconception that past events influence future probabilities—can lead players to make irrational betting decisions, thinking that a win is ‘due’ after a series of losses.

Moreover, emotions play a critical role in gambling. The thrill of winning can create a powerful rush, which may cloud judgment and lead to reckless decisions. On the other hand, losing can trigger frustration and a desire to chase losses, influencing players to bet bigger than they normally would. Recognizing these psychological triggers can help players develop more effective strategies in navigating casino games.

The Influence of Environment on Gambling Behavior
The physical and psychological environment of a casino can greatly impact a player’s behavior and decision-making. Factors such as lighting, sounds, and even the layout of the casino are meticulously designed to create an immersive experience that encourages prolonged play. For example, the sounds of bells and whistles or the sight of flashing lights can evoke excitement, leading gamblers to stay longer and spend more.
Furthermore, social interactions within the casino environment—whether with other players, dealers, or through competitive gameplay—can influence decision-making. The sense of camaraderie or the pressure to perform can push players to take risks they might not otherwise consider. Being aware of these environmental factors can help gamblers maintain focus and make better strategic choices.
